Experience with Two-Chamber and Mult-i-cell Modular, Flexible Low Pressure and High Pressure Vacuum Carburizing Automated Furnace Lines in Commercial Heat Treating Environments

J. Zhou, Ipsen International, Inc., Cherry Valley, IL

View in WORD format

Summary: Today's most advanced approach to vacuum carburizing uses multiple independent carburizing and quenching chambers with automated load handling. Unlike in-line multi-chamber furnaces, the processing times of the various cells are decoupled for high scheduling flexibility and maximum productivity. Understand the unique and flexible design features and performance results obtained from a two-chamber and mult-i-cell system.
